NCPB definition

NCPB means the National Cereals & Produce Board or party who employs the Service Provider
NCPB means the National Cereals and Produce Board established pursuant to Chapter 338 of the Borrower’s Laws;
NCPB wherever appearing means National Cereals & Produce Board
